Output 3c79a917bf05c3e81309cd45ee84ce7613cff4363a2a6dc5782d25386f276617:1

value
6973010561572
script pubkey
OP_0 OP_PUSHBYTES_20 b408f24f57aaa0a69180aa702f6f76b5964c2751
address
tb1qksy0yn6h42s2dyvq4fcz7mmkkktycf63skqzz2
transaction
3c79a917bf05c3e81309cd45ee84ce7613cff4363a2a6dc5782d25386f276617
confirmations
162099
spent
true